Music plays a vital role in Indonesian youth culture. Genres like dangdut (a fusion of traditional and modern music), pop, and hip-hop are extremely popular among young people. Indonesian artists like Isyana Sarasvati, Nidji, and Rich Chigga have gained international recognition, showcasing the country's rich musical talent. Additionally, K-pop and J-pop have a significant following in Indonesia, with many fans attending concerts and festivals.
